debuggers.hg

log

age author revision description
2007-12-04 Keir Fraser 16555:62717554d4cb docs: Fix interface manual to correctly reference
2007-12-04 Keir Fraser 16554:aa430556d33f Merge with ia64.
2007-11-30 Alex Williamson 16553:32ec5dbe2978 merge with xen-unstable.hg
2007-11-29 Alex Williamson 16552:f9ca1d8c9e65 [IA64] Implement guest_os_type for ia64
2007-11-29 Alex Williamson 16551:8d5487ca222f [IA64] Provide backing for XEN_DOMCTL_set_opt_feature
2007-11-29 Alex Williamson 16550:1de4e5056394 [IA64] Create XEN_DOMCTL_set_opt_feature
2007-11-29 Alex Williamson 16549:ad5fa636bc4e [IA64] Create common guest_os_type domain config option
2007-11-28 Alex Williamson 16548:22f7a7a42b86 [IA64] Fix assign_domain_mmio_page
2007-11-28 Alex Williamson 16547:c4ed92fb0d05 [IA64] Only use streamlined entry/exit for xen hypercall.
2007-11-28 Alex Williamson 16546:0cc58b6dfeb2 [IA64] vcpu_setcontext: only set cr_irr if VGCF_SET_CR_IRR flag is set.
2007-11-26 Alex Williamson 16545:98defc4f3bf9 [IA64] Add physical to physical data only and reverse transitions.
2007-11-26 Alex Williamson 16544:4ac315e33f88 [IA64] Extract debug_op.h from arch-ia64.h
2007-12-04 Keir Fraser 16543:0c234da66b4a x86: clean up mm.c and cache 'current' where appropriate.
2007-12-04 Keir Fraser 16542:ebfb3b26010d blkif interface: Add BLKIF_OP_FLUSH_DISKCACHE.
2007-12-04 Keir Fraser 16541:b1da8762f853 blktap: remove unused headers.
2007-12-04 Keir Fraser 16540:9ce9d43a76a2 tboot, xen: Update for Trusted Boot v20071128.
2007-12-04 Keir Fraser 16539:d1e1db24bd5f xend: Implement get_by_name_label for class XendNetwork
2007-12-04 Keir Fraser 16538:7bee812a0397 Fix xenmon.py to work on Solaris
2007-12-04 Keir Fraser 16537:0e8e68cfc8ac vt-d: Print messages when:
2007-12-04 Keir Fraser 16536:d2bef6551c12 xsm: Consolidate xsm processing within domain control hypercall.
2007-12-04 Keir Fraser 16535:190c2592247d xentrace: Don't append trace on existing file.
2007-12-04 Keir Fraser 16534:6e7cf648f7f3 domain builder: make mmap() failure message more verbose.
2007-12-04 Keir Fraser 16533:01faea565a9b mini-os: No -fpic when building for x86.
2007-12-04 Keir Fraser 16532:7573133112c5 vnet: Fix compilation on x86/64 which erroneously asserts
2007-12-04 Keir Fraser 16531:f54b2dd57037 vnet: Fix compilation.
2007-12-04 Keir Fraser 16530:8e3d42fdb8e7 x86: Move get_page/put_page out of header file, and only print on
2007-11-29 Keir Fraser 16529:3057f813da14 x86_emulate: Fix POPA. Few other cleanups.
2007-11-28 Keir Fraser 16528:e10eacec8b91 vmx: Better tracing in vmcs_dump_vcpu() -- grab RIP/RSP/RFLAGS from
2007-11-28 Keir Fraser 16527:0b9048f7f257 x86_emulate: Emulate SHLD and SHRD instructions.
2007-11-28 Keir Fraser 16526:c555a5f97982 domctl: Fix handling of size parameter in ext_vcpucontext domctl commands.
2007-11-28 Keir Fraser 16525:71bfeeb0b321 xsm: Fix linker script integration for xsm initcall list.
2007-11-28 Keir Fraser 16524:c00f31f27de6 hvm: Fix 2 type mismatches in vlapic.h and hpet.c for 32-bit build Xen
2007-11-28 Keir Fraser 16523:c76a9aa12d2e hvm: Inject #UD for un-emulated instructions rather than crash guest
2007-11-28 Keir Fraser 16522:bb31c9325d5f Fix string length check for vsnprintf() in debugtrace_printk().
2007-11-28 Keir Fraser 16521:43b7d24acf9c x86_emulate: Emulate RDTSC instruction.
2007-11-28 Keir Fraser 16520:cca2f2fb857d x86_emulate: Emulate ENTER and LEAVE instructions.
2007-11-28 Keir Fraser 16519:3fdbdd131fc7 [Mini-OS] Catch NULL dereferences
2007-11-28 Keir Fraser 16518:74bd94747ca3 [Mini-OS] Fix strrchr() when string doesn't contain the character.
2007-11-28 Keir Fraser 16517:8d406e2813c8 [Mini-OS] Make gnttab allocation/free safe
2007-11-28 Keir Fraser 16516:f173cd885ffb vt-d: Some fixes and cleanup of Intel iommu
2007-11-27 Keir Fraser 16515:6fd17d0dcbcd minios: Revert 16206:7b5b65fbaf61 (xenbus wait fixup)
2007-11-27 Keir Fraser 16514:3b71ee29c282 x86_emulate: Fix use-before-initialise warning.
2007-11-26 Keir Fraser 16513:26e766e0c628 vmx realmode: Slight finessing of an error path.
2007-11-26 Keir Fraser 16512:f9a43c6b5be1 vmx realmode: When returning to protected mode we have to massage the
2007-11-26 Keir Fraser 16511:4d6f92fa1014 vmx realmode: Emulate writes to control registers.
2007-11-26 Keir Fraser 16510:f676c0dacbb9 x86_emulate: Emulate LMSW and SMSW.
2007-11-26 Keir Fraser 16509:4deb65519d9b x86 emulate: Emulate atomic read-modify-write instructions as a
2007-11-26 Keir Fraser 16508:11bfa26dd125 vmx realmode: Fix emulation of exception delivery (stack pointer must
2007-11-26 Keir Fraser 16507:c5332fa8b68d x86_emulate: Emulate RETF and RETF imm16.
2007-11-26 Keir Fraser 16506:9f61a0add5b6 x86_emulate: Emulate CPUID and HLT.
2007-11-26 Keir Fraser 16505:dc3a566f9e44 x86_emulate: Emulate LDS/LES/LFS/LGS/LSS.
2007-11-25 Keir Fraser 16504:bb961bda7eff vmx realmode: Detect and correctly plumb mmio accesses from emulated
2007-11-25 Keir Fraser 16503:6d129d093394 x86_emulate: Emulate CMPS and SCAS string-compare instructions.
2007-11-25 Keir Fraser 16502:7c6944d861b2 x86_emulate: Emulate IRET.
2007-11-25 Keir Fraser 16501:502f5b9469c3 x86_emulate: Decode and emulate PUSHF/POPF.
2007-11-25 Keir Fraser 16500:f6a587e3d5c9 x86_emulate: Allow emulated injection of exceptions and interrupts.
2007-11-25 Keir Fraser 16499:d40788f07a4f x86_emulate: Emulate far call/jmp. This completes emulation of Grp5.
2007-11-25 Keir Fraser 16498:a194083696d5 vmx realmode: Support privileged EFLAGS updates in emulated realmode.
2007-11-25 Keir Fraser 16497:368bcf480772 vmx realmode: Plumb through I/O port accesses in emulated realmode.
2007-11-25 Keir Fraser 16496:ce3e5e859d66 vt-d: Fix iommu_map_page().
2007-11-24 Keir Fraser 16495:9fd36167ecfa Remove unused bcopy() implementation.
2007-11-24 Keir Fraser 16494:ad632e4f26d4 Revert 16450:5e8e82e80. Instead remove all arch-specific handling of
2007-11-24 Keir Fraser 16493:51082cf273d4 vmx: Initial framework for real-mode emulation (disabled by default).
2007-11-24 Keir Fraser 16492:d5c396128897 x86_emulate: Support most common segment load/save instructions.
2007-11-24 Keir Fraser 16491:2e7fcea74cb1 x86: Fix read/write control-register in x86_emulate().
2007-11-24 Keir Fraser 16490:b92239112869 vt-d: Some fixes of Intel iommu
2007-11-24 Keir Fraser 16489:483329e219c9 [ACM] Remove aggregate set calculations for Domain-0
2007-11-24 Keir Fraser 16488:5e8e82e80f3b Fix non-optimized compilation of Xen's memcmp
2007-11-24 Keir Fraser 16487:96409cebd74b [Mini-OS] Fix domain blocking race
2007-11-24 Keir Fraser 16486:2c52520f3284 [Mini-OS] Permit x86_64 trap handlers to return
2007-11-24 Keir Fraser 16485:ee519207734f [Mini-OS] Make sure schedule() is called safely
2007-11-24 Keir Fraser 16484:7eea09b18839 [Mini-OS] Fix netfront xmit overflow
2007-11-24 Keir Fraser 16483:eac7ef8ba544 [Mini-OS] Fix net backend path leak
2007-11-24 Keir Fraser 16482:2fd1ead7fdf5 [Mini-OS] Make wake_up callback-safe
2007-11-24 Keir Fraser 16481:fb7b96a980f6 [Mini-OS] Fix init_waitqueue_entry
2007-11-24 Keir Fraser 16480:ebb61551565b [Mini-OS] Add init_SEMAPHORE
2007-11-24 Keir Fraser 16479:9e88db95ddc7 [Mini-OS] Make semaphores callback-safe
2007-11-24 Keir Fraser 16478:0814fb0f8a4d x86, hvm: Config option to allow vmxassist to be disabled.
2007-11-23 Keir Fraser 16477:dc9246357cdb [Mini-OS] Add strrchr()
2007-11-23 Keir Fraser 16476:b1324eca1cd9 [Mini-OS] Add ENOTSUP
2007-11-23 Keir Fraser 16475:c9c476a22036 [Mini-OS] Move _ctype into a module
2007-11-23 Keir Fraser 16474:81e63d66a64d vt-d: Fix ISA IRQ alias issue
2007-11-23 Keir Fraser 16473:e40015e20548 [Mini-OS] Make bind_virq return the port
2007-11-23 Keir Fraser 16472:d46265d21dc5 [Mini-OS] Fix x86 arch_switch_thread
2007-11-23 Keir Fraser 16471:2215f4f6f0f2 [Mini-OS] Optimize get_current()
2007-11-23 Keir Fraser 16470:f28d36628de8 [Mini-OS] Fix stack closures
2007-11-23 Keir Fraser 16469:75cb82d277be [Mini-OS] Fix x86 initial stack alignment
2007-11-23 Keir Fraser 16468:2e05a6173be0 xend: Add support for NetBSD.
2007-11-22 Keir Fraser 16467:f2711b7eae95 hvm: Clean up VMCS/VMCB construction.
2007-11-22 Keir Fraser 16466:69b56d3289f5 x86: emulate I/O port access breakpoints
2007-11-22 Keir Fraser 16465:fd3f6d814f6d x86: single step after instruction emulation
2007-11-22 Keir Fraser 16464:ae087a0fa2c9 acm: Fix an exit label.
2007-11-22 Keir Fraser 16463:d3041196ae69 netfront/back: Specify interface allowing multicast address add/remove
2007-11-22 Keir Fraser 16462:5e85709e998b [SVM] handle MC threshold registers for Barcelona
2007-11-22 Keir Fraser 16461:66a7ff355762 x86: make set_task_gate() x86-32-only since x86-64 doesn't have task gates.
2007-11-22 Keir Fraser 16460:db98e4676d3f x86-64: access only 4 bytes a the reset vector location on smpboot.
2007-11-22 Keir Fraser 16459:5b1120109823 Header dependency fix.
2007-11-22 Keir Fraser 16458:980b8d1a5541 Merge with ia64 tree.
2007-11-21 Alex Williamson 16457:53dc1cf50506 merge with xen-unstable.hg (staging)
2007-11-20 Alex Williamson 16456:9a9ddc04eea2 merge with xen-unstable.hg (staging)
2007-11-20 Alex Williamson 16455:87afd05bd254 [IA64] vti save-restore: save.h clean up
2007-11-20 Alex Williamson 16454:e6acebec04a2 [IA64] vti save-restore: save/restore opt_feature status
2007-11-20 Alex Williamson 16453:6fc79cb7934d [IA64] vti save-restore: preparation opt_feature support
2007-11-20 Alex Williamson 16452:b444678b94ea [IA64] vti save-restore: fix opt_feature hypercall
2007-11-20 Alex Williamson 16451:428679ca60d8 [IA64] vti save-restore: fix vacpi_save()
2007-11-22 Keir Fraser 16450:7186e9611d55 libxc: Minor clean up of xc_core, and fix for -fstrict-overflow.
2007-11-22 Keir Fraser 16449:93d129d27f69 hvm: Clean up CPUID 0x80000001 emulation. Filter out RDTSCP feature
2007-11-21 Keir Fraser 16448:05cbf512b82b x86: rmb() can be weakened according to new Intel spec.
2007-11-21 Keir Fraser 16447:7ccf7d373d0e x86: Re-factor and clean up system.h.
2007-11-21 Keir Fraser 16446:6301c3b6e1ba i386: Remove unnecessary, and broken, address check I added to seg
2007-11-21 Keir Fraser 16445:81aa410fa662 i386: adjustment to segment fixup code.
2007-11-21 Keir Fraser 16444:8c305873f2b8 x86: Make IDT/GDT/LDT updates safe.
2007-11-21 Keir Fraser 16443:ec0bc82cebfd ioemu: Add e100 NIC support. Req'd for w2k3/IA64.
2007-11-21 Keir Fraser 16442:ae6f4c7f15cb hvm: Do not crash guest if it does an unaligned access to an HPET
2007-11-21 Keir Fraser 16441:00fec8212ae6 Remove unused smpboot.h header file.
2007-11-20 Keir Fraser 16440:2e5d922b7ee3 xen: Allow granting of foreign access to iomem pages, and with
2007-11-20 Keir Fraser 16439:f62e6c697eeb x86, 32-on-64: Improve checking in vcpu_destroy_pagetables(). It *is*
2007-11-20 Keir Fraser 16438:94b3979606cd xenapi: Extension to get vif total i/o stats.
2007-11-20 Keir Fraser 16437:2022cbc842af ACM: Test sharing as part of the authorization check.
2007-11-20 Keir Fraser 16436:bc6aaa44e296 svm: Fix __update_guest_eip() to clear interrupt shadow.